Well...time for a little science fiction tonight. Above was the photo I shot for GL's last photo contest, featuring my Stormtroopers in an "action" scene. I didn't place in the contest, but that really wasn't my goal as much as trying something different. I spent a lot of time working up my Mandalorian Stormtroopers, but never really had any plans for them in terms of featuring them in a story or series of stories. Sci Fi is just hard to do if you ask me; coming up with sets and locations, etc. The contest though was a chance to experiment with an idea that had been lurking in the back of my mind...that of doing a series of comic book covers with different figures...kind of "what might have been" story ideas (that is if I had more time for that sort of thing). A concept I am calling "THE PHOTO VIGNETTE". Right now, at this particular time in my life, I don't really have time or the space to build physical vignettes for my figures, but I can create photographic vignettes because they don't take up any space, except for megs on my hard drive.
    So...the discussion for this UPDATE is how would you define a Photo Vignette. If this a topic that interests you, tell me what you think the definition of a photo vignette would be and flesh out the concept. My own idea is something like what you see above, figures featured on magazine covers, but that is just one concept. I am sure that there are a whole lot more ideas out there.
